Perimenopause

Perimenopause

Perimenopause is a natural transitional phase that marks the lead-up to menopause. It typically begins in a woman's 40s, though it can start earlier, and may last several years. This period is characterized by fluctuations in hormone levels, particularly estrogen and progesterone, which can lead to a variety of physical and emotional symptoms.

From a naturopathic perspective, the goal is to support the body in achieving balance and easing the transition, while addressing underlying factors contributing to symptoms.


Common symptoms of perimenenopause:


  1. Irregular Periods: Changes in cycle length or skipped periods.
  2. Hot Flashes and Night Sweats: Sudden feelings of heat or excessive sweating.
  3. Mood Changes: Increased anxiety, irritability, or mood swings.
  4. Sleep Disturbances: Difficulty falling or staying asleep.
  5. Decreased Libido: Changes in sexual desire or discomfort during intimacy.
  6. Weight Gain or Metabolic Changes: Often due to shifts in hormonal balance.
  7. Cognitive Changes: Cognitive changes, forgetfulness, brain fog, difficulty concentrating
  8. Other Symptoms: CHeadaches, sore muscles and joints, sore breasts, urinary urgency, itchy ears

GUT Health

Gut Health

From a Naturopathic perspective gut health is the foundation of well being. Beyond digestion, your gut is deeply connected to your immune system, hormonal balance, mental clarity, and energy levels. A healthy gut means your body can absorb nutrients, eliminate waste efficiently, and maintain balance in all its systems.


When the gut is out of balance, whether from stress, diet and lifestyle choices, medications, environmental toxins, t can lead to symptoms like bloating, fatigue, brain fog, skin issues, or even emotional shifts like anxiety. These are signals that your body needs support.


Through Naturopathic care and functional medicine testing, we can identify and address the root causes of gut imbalance. Using personalized nutrition, herbal medicine, supplementation, lifestyle adjustments and other natural medicinals, we can help restore your gut to a state of balance and vitality. Thyroid health

Thyroid Disorders

Our thyroid is the master gland of your metabolism and thyroid hormone is active in almost every cell of your body.  An underactive thyroid (hypothyroid), an overactive thyroid (hyperthyroid) or a thyroid that is being attacked by your own immune system (Hashimoto’s thyroiditis, Grave’s disease) can impair your overall body’s functioning and leave you feeling unwell. 


Common signs of a poorly functioning thyroid:


  • Fatigue and Low energy  
  • Intolerance of Cold or Heat
  • Constipation or Frequent Bowel Movements
  • Skin and Hair Changes
  • Weight Gain or Weight Loss  
  • Anxiety, Depression   
  • Muscle Aches
  • Memory Problems  
  • Menstrual Changes
  • Restlessness, Sweating, Rapid Heart Rate, Tremors


​The conventional approach commonly uses TSH in screening for thyroid, if this is normal no further testing is done.  However, many patients with a “normal” TSH still present with symptoms and may require more comprehensive thyroid testing.  Dr. Bizios will perform a comprehensive thyroid panel, and screen for nutritional deficiencies related to thyroid health. Stress & Adrenal Fatigue

Stress & Adrenal Fatigue

The adrenal gland makes hormones like cortisol that help your body respond to stress.  However, chronic stress puts your adrenals in to overdrive and in time their ability to make hormones becomes impaired, the result is adrenal dysfunction or "adenal fatigue".  


Some common signs of adrenal fatigue:

 ​  

  • Always Tired   
  • Inability to Handle Stress
  • Difficulty Waking, Unrefreshed by Sleep, Sleep Problems
  • Belly Fat  
  • Dark Circles Under Eyes
  • Low Back Pain
  • Mental Fogginess
  • Blood Sugar Problems
  • Low libido  
  • Getting Sick Easily
  • Eczema, Asthma, Allergies

SIBO

SIBO/SIFO

SIBO (Small Intestinal Bacterial Overgrowth) SIFO (Small Intestinal Fungal Overgrowth)


SIBO/SIFO hav become more and more prevalent in our patient population. SIBO/SIFO is the result of a bacterial or fungal overgrowth that occurs when levels of commensal bacteria (from the mouth, small or large intestine) increase in the small intestine. This overgrowth impacts overall digestion and nutrient absorption and is often the underlying cause of IBS. SIBO can be measured by specialized breath tests that measure gases produced when carbohydrates are digested or fermented by intestinal bacteria. Elevated levels of these gases indicate a possible SIBO etiology. 


Common symptoms of SIBO/SIFO include the following:


  • · Bloating or abdominal gas
  • · Heartburn
  • · Nausea
  • · Abdominal pain and cramps
  • · Constipation, diarrhea or alternating constipation and diarrhea
  • · Malabsorption (steatorrhea and anemia)


SIBO/SIFO may be present when you experience any of the following; a worsening of digestive symptoms with probiotics/prebiotics, constipation that is made worse with fiber, no improvement with a gluten-free diet, a chronic iron or B12 deficiency, IBS that develops suddenly after the stomach flu, antibiotic therapy that improves overall digestive symptoms, long-term reflux medications (proton pump inhibitors), gallbladder and bile problems.

Naturopathic treatment can be very successful. Herbal medicine, detoxification, supplementation, enzyme therapy and diet modification are commonly used.

Fertility

Fertility

Roughly 1 in 6 couples experience infertility, a number which has doubled since the 1980’s.  Nutrient deficiencies caused by poor dietary habits, food and environmental chemical exposure, stress, inactivity, advanced parental age and unhealthy lifestyles are contributing to this statistic.  

We help future parents optimize their health prior to conception by offering a Fertility Enhancement Program to support a healthier start to a new life. 


Fertility Enhancement Program


On average, it takes 100 days for an egg to mature and for sperm to develop, for this reason, prenatal care should begin closer to 4 months prior to conception.  Once egg and sperm come together, a permanent blueprint of baby is formed.  This blueprint mirrors the overall health, nutrient status and toxic load of the egg and sperm over the past 100 days.  Naturopathic care takes advantage of this window and aims to support the growth and development of healthier embryos that grow in to healthier babies.
